On Fri, Jan 19, 2018 at 6:22 AM, Robert Haas <robertmhaas@gmail.com> wrote:
>> (3)
>> erm, maybe it's a problem that errors occurring in workers while the
>> leader is waiting at a barrier won't unblock the leader (we don't
>> detach from barriers on abort/exit) -- I'll look into this.
>
> I think if there's an ERROR, the general parallelism machinery is
> going to arrange to kill every worker, so nothing matters in that case
> unless barrier waits ignore interrupts, which I'm pretty sure they
> don't.  (Also: if they do, I'll hit the ceiling; that would be awful.)

(After talking this through with Robert off-list).  Right, the
CHECK_FOR_INTERRUPTS() in ConditionVariableSleep() handles errors from
parallel workers.  There is no problem here.
